Home
last modified time | relevance | path

Searched refs:sync_compare_and_swap (Results 1 – 12 of 12) sorted by relevance

/NextBSD/contrib/gcc/config/sparc/
HDsync.md60 (define_expand "sync_compare_and_swap<mode>"
72 (define_expand "sync_compare_and_swap<mode>"
91 (define_insn "*sync_compare_and_swap<mode>"
/NextBSD/contrib/gcc/config/i386/
HDsync.md41 (define_expand "sync_compare_and_swap<mode>"
74 (define_insn "*sync_compare_and_swap<mode>"
/NextBSD/contrib/gcc/config/ia64/
HDsync.md113 (define_expand "sync_compare_and_swap<mode>"
/NextBSD/contrib/gcc/
HDoptabs.h504 extern enum insn_code sync_compare_and_swap[NUM_MACHINE_MODES];
HDoptabs.c5361 sync_compare_and_swap[i] = CODE_FOR_nothing; in init_optabs()
5812 enum insn_code icode = sync_compare_and_swap[mode]; in expand_val_compare_and_swap()
5845 icode = sync_compare_and_swap[mode]; in expand_bool_compare_and_swap()
5964 icode = sync_compare_and_swap[mode]; in expand_compare_and_swap_loop()
6049 if (sync_compare_and_swap[mode] != CODE_FOR_nothing) in expand_sync_operation()
6201 if (sync_compare_and_swap[mode] != CODE_FOR_nothing) in expand_sync_fetch_operation()
6268 if (sync_compare_and_swap[mode] != CODE_FOR_nothing) in expand_sync_lock_test_and_set()
HDChangeLog-2005350 (sync_compare_and_swap<mode>): Change into expand, use CASMODE
353 (*sync_compare_and_swap<mode>): New insn.
6266 ("sync_compare_and_swap<mode>"): Replace with a define_expand.
6267 ("sync_compare_and_swap<mode>_cc"): Replace GPR with TDSI.
6268 ("*sync_compare_and_swap<mode>_cc"): Replace with one pattern for
11496 (sync_compare_and_swap<mode>): Same.
12081 (sync_compare_and_swap<I48MODE>): Likewise.
12083 (sync_compare_and_swap<I12MODE>): New.
12084 (sync_compare_and_swap<I12MODE>_1): New.
12109 (sync_compare_and_swap<mode>): Same.
[all …]
HDgimplify.c5200 if (sync_compare_and_swap[TYPE_MODE (itype)] == CODE_FOR_nothing) in gimplify_omp_atomic_pipeline()
HDexpr.c230 enum insn_code sync_compare_and_swap[NUM_MACHINE_MODES]; variable
HDChangeLog-200616723 * config/rs6000/sync.md (sync_compare_and_swap{hi,qi}): New.
/NextBSD/contrib/gcc/config/rs6000/
HDsync.md69 (define_insn_and_split "sync_compare_and_swap<mode>"
/NextBSD/contrib/gcc/config/s390/
HDs390.md7382 (define_expand "sync_compare_and_swap<mode>"
7396 (define_expand "sync_compare_and_swap<mode>"
7434 (define_insn "*sync_compare_and_swap<mode>"
7451 (define_insn "*sync_compare_and_swap<mode>"
/NextBSD/contrib/gcc/doc/
HDmd.texi4512 @cindex @code{sync_compare_and_swap@var{mode}} instruction pattern
4513 @item @samp{sync_compare_and_swap@var{mode}}
4534 This pattern is just like @code{sync_compare_and_swap@var{mode}}, except
4543 definition for @code{sync_compare_and_swap@var{mode}}.